2 / 11 page ![]() October 2011 © 2011 Fairchild Semiconductor Corporation www.fairchildsemi.com FMS6404 • Rev. 1.0.0 FMS6404 Precision Composite Video Output with Sound Trap and Group Delay Compensation Features 7.6MHz 5th-Order Composite Video Filter 14dB Notch at 4.425MHz to 4.6MHz for Sound Trap Capable of Handling Stereo 50dB Stopband Attenuation at 27MHz on CV Output > 0.5dB Flatness to 4.2MHz on CV Output Equalizer and Notch Filter for Driving RF Modulator with Group Delay of -180ns No External Frequency Selection Components or Clocks < 5ns Group Delay on CV Output AC-Coupled Input AC- or DC-Coupled Output Capable of PAL Frequency for CV Continuous Time Low-Pass Filters <1.4% Differential Gain with 0.7° Differential Phase on CV Channel Integrated DC Restore Circuitry with Low Tilt Applications Cable Set-Top Boxes Satellite Set-Top Boxes DVD Players Description The FMS6404 is a single composite video 5th-order Butterworth low-pass video filter optimized for minimum overshoot and flat group delay. The device contains an audio trap that removes video information in a spectral location of the subsequent RF audio carrier. The group delay compensation circuit pre-distorts the signal to compensate for the inherent receiver intermediate frequency (IF) filter’s group delay distortion. In a typical application, the composite video from the DAC is AC coupled into the filter. The CV input has DC- restore circuitry to clamp the DC input levels during video synchronization. The clamp pulse is derived from the CV channel. All outputs are capable of driving 2VPP, AC- or DC- coupled, into either a single or dual video load. A single video load consists of a series 75Ω impedance matching resistor connected to a terminated 75Ω line. This presents a total of 150Ω of loading to the part. A dual load would be two of these in parallel, which presents a total of 75Ω to the part. The gain of the CV signal is 6dB with 1VPP input levels. All video channels are clamped during synchronization to establish the appropriate output voltage reference levels.
